Chips and Dents

Windows let natural light be able to enter your home and fresh air to circulate however, they can also be damaged through storms and accidents. When this happens windows' panes could chip or crack and frames and sashes could become misaligned. Call a professional to fix your windows if they need repair. The cost of this service is contingent on the type of glass and the extent of damage.

In general, homeowners spend between $150 to $650 to have their double-hung windows repaired professionally. The sash window includes two panels that are able to move independently in order to let air and light in. Sash locks, frames and sashes may all have issues that require repair by a professional.

The cost to replace a single window glass can vary based on the size of the window and the design of the frame. The window screen can be replaced at a cost. cost.

The elements and the sun can cause window frames to fade or peel their paint. Accidents or other causes can also cause holes, cracks, and dents. If any of these problems occur, the frame should be replaced or repaired professionally to avoid further damage to the window and the wall.

Professionals charge between $75 and $200 to replace a window hinge dependent on the frame type and material. These are the long, metal pieces stretching and extending when you open certain types of windows. Window hinges are typically susceptible to being damaged by accidents or weathering, leading to needing repair or replacement.

The lintel forms a part of the window's opening that helps support the weight of the wall that is above it. Lintels can be made of concrete or bricks, and they can also rot crack, break, or split. You can repair them with patching and repair methods. However, they might require replacement completely when they're badly damaged or damaged by pressure or moisture. Professional lintel repair can cost between $400 and $700.

Condensation and fog

If moisture develops between the panes of your windows, it's a clear sign that the seal on your insulated glass unit (IGU) has failed. This means that your windows aren't as effective as they could be at keeping heat in during winter and cool air out during summer. It's possible to fix this issue without replacing the entire window.

Most modern double- and triple-pane windows are insulated glass units (IGUs). These windows consist of two or more panes held together by a rubber gasket, and inert gases such as argon or Krypton. Over time the gases may be less effective and allow moisture to get inside the glass, leading to condensation.

Foggy windows are a typical problem, especially in humid regions where temperature changes can cause the gasket to wear down and allow moisture in. This can result in a significant decrease in energy efficiency, and even damage the frames made of wood and the glass of your windows if left unchecked.

There are a myriad of solutions to the issue of double-paned windows fogging. One way is to drill an opening between the two glass panes and spray in a defogging solution. The solution will dissolve any mildew that has accumulated up and then suck away any excess moisture. This method is usually only suitable for glass that is softened however, because it can damage toughened and safety glass if it is used on them.

Damaged Frames

The cost of double glazing near me will differ based on the type of window used and the extent of the damage. Minor issues with a small window frame may just require a few hours of labor and materials, while the most severe damage to a huge window bow could require many hours and many materials. In addition, the original material of the window can affect the cost of repair. Aluminum frames, for instance, are less expensive to repair than wooden frames.

It is recommended to arrange an inspection and consult with an expert to determine what it will cost to repair double glaze repair near me glazing. During the inspection, a knowledgeable professional will inspect the frame, glass and insulation for any issues or damage. The professional will then provide you an estimate of the cost of the repair.

If your window is under warranty, the window manufacturer could cover the cost of an exchange of the insulation glass unit (IGU) in the event that the seal fails within a specified timeframe. Examine the documentation you received when you bought your house to determine if there is such an assurance, and make sure to keep all documentation from the window installation.

The cost of replacing the seal on a window that has been blown out can be expensive. The cost to replace one pane of glass could range from about PS100 for a small window, up to PS850 for a larger bay window. However, it is possible to replace just a section of the window, rather than the entire frame and sash which can save you money.

Some companies offer defogging solutions that inject insulating gases between the windows in order to minimize fog and condensation. The reviews for this method, however, are mixed. The process does not replace the inert gases. Therefore, the fog and condensation that first developed could be re-created.

In addition to replacing a single window pane experts can also repair or replace frames, hinges and other hardware on casement windows, awning, hopper and sliding windows. They can replace the window sill that is damaged or warped. Although many homeowners can fix drafty window, it's usually a job best left to professionals.

Poor Insulation

Double-paned windows today are often filled with an argon layer to stop loss of heat. This non-toxic and odorless gas helps to keep your home cooler during summer and warmer in winter. It's also among the most advanced features of modern windows, and can improve your home’s efficiency by lowering energy bills. If you've noticed that your window has lost a significant amount of gas, a window professional can make use of a specific instrument to replace it.

If the seal on a double-paned window is not sealed cold or hot air can be able to circulate between the two glass panes. This undermines the insulating properties of your window and can put undue stress on your home's heating or cooling system. This issue should be addressed as soon as possible, since it can lead increased energy costs and more repairs.

Calling for a quote on window repair is something that window professionals recommend you do before the issue worsens. In many instances, window repair experts will have to examine your windows to give a more precise estimate. The cost to repair double-paned windows can vary in relation to its size, style, and the complexity. The addition of a new insulation layer, removing moisture or replacing a window's sash will increase the overall cost of the project.

Fog in insulated glass could be caused by condensation or humidity between the window panes. This issue is expensive to fix as it could cause mold or mildew growth and decrease the insulation properties of the window. If you have a problem with your insulated window or when it's not sealed properly or if there's condensation between the glass frame and the glass, it's crucial to get it repaired promptly by a window expert.

Re-sealing a double-paned windows can sometimes resolve the fogging issue. This is a temporary fix but it won't bring back the original energy efficiency of your window. It is more cost-effective to replace double-paned windows than to repair them.
